/* CSS Document */
body
{	font-family:Arial, Helvetica, sans-serif;
	font-size:10pt;
	/*background-image:url(../pics/bg_primary.jpg);*/
	/*background-repeat:repeat-x;*/
	background-color:#004876;
	/*background-attachment:fixed;*/
	color:#fff;
	text-align:center;}

body, form, p, span, img, ul
{	padding:0;
	margin:0;}

ul
{	list-style-type:disc;
	margin-left:15px;
}

ul li
{	
	background-repeat:no-repeat;
	padding-left:0px;
	margin-left:25px;
	margin-top:3px;
}

img
{	border:0;}

a
{	text-decoration:none;}

.inputtxt, .inputpas, select
{	border:1px solid #7e8182;
	color:#7e8182;}

textarea
{	overflow:auto;}

#pagecon
{	margin:30px auto 0 auto;
	padding-bottom:30px;
	/*width:970px;*/
	width:1013px;
	text-align:left;
}

#preload
{	display:none;}

.clear
{	clear:both;}

/*x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x Linking Mods x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x*/
.stlink
{	color:#88c8ff;}

.stlink:hover
{	color:#0071fd;}

.creostudioslink
{
color:#fff;
}

.creostudioslink:hover
{
color:#fff;
}

/*x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x Font Size Mods x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x*/
.bt_7
{
font-size:7pt;
}

.bt_8
{
font-size:8pt;
}

.bt_9
{
font-size:9pt;
}

.bt_10
{
font-size:10pt;
}


.bt_11
{
font-size:11pt;
}


.bt_12
{
font-size:12pt;
}


.bt_13
{
font-size:13pt;
}


.bt_14
{
font-size:14pt;
}

.bt_15
{
font-size:15pt;
}


.bt_16
{
font-size:16pt;
}


.bt_17
{
font-size:17pt;
}


.bt_18
{
font-size:18pt;
}


.bt_19
{
font-size:19pt;
}

.bt_20
{
font-size:20pt;
}

/*x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x Download Flash Player Mods xxxxxxxxxxxxxxxxxxxxxxxx*/
.getflashplayercon
{
height:60px;
text-align:center;
}

.getflashplayer_link
{
margin:0 10px 0 0;
}

.getflashplayer_defs
{
margin:0px 0 0 0;
}

/*x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x Fonts Color x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x*/
.yellow
{
color:#ffc600;
}

.darkblue
{
color:#004876;
}

.lightblue
{
color:#88c8ff;
}


/*x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x Specifics x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x*/
.mainbannercon
{
height:295px;
background:url(../pics/bg_mainbanner.png) no-repeat;
margin-bottom:8px;
position:relative;
}

.homelinker
{
position:absolute;
top:17px;
left:155px;
}

.contentcon
{
background:url(../pics/bg_contentmid.png) repeat-y;
}

.content_mainmenuscon
{
height:83px;
background:url(../pics/bg_contentupper.png) no-repeat;
/*position:relative;*/
}

.content_mainmenus_innercon
{
height:83px;
position:relative;
}


.mm_home_up, .mm_home_hover, .mm_giflinker_home
{
width:74px;
height:32px;
position:absolute;
top:20px;
left:425px;
}


.mm_products_up, .mm_products_hover, .mm_giflinker_products
{
width:105px;
height:32px;
position:absolute;
top:20px;
left:560px;
}

.mm_contactus_up, .mm_contactus_hover, .mm_giflinker_contactus
{
width:135px;
height:32px;
position:absolute;
top:20px;
left:730px;
}

.mm_home_up
{
background:url(../pics/mm_home_up.png) no-repeat;
}

.mm_home_hover
{
background:url(../pics/mm_home_hover.png) no-repeat;
}

.mm_products_up
{
background:url(../pics/mm_products_up.png) no-repeat;
}

.mm_products_hover
{
background:url(../pics/mm_products_hover.png) no-repeat;
}

.mm_contactus_up
{
background:url(../pics/mm_contactus_up.png) no-repeat;
}

.mm_contactus_hover
{
background:url(../pics/mm_contactus_hover.png) no-repeat;
}



.content_mainbody
{
width:950px;
margin:0 0 0 27px;
}

.cm_leftcon
{
width:273px;
margin:0 20px 0 0;
float:left;
}

.home_subbanner
{
text-align:right;
}

.home_subbanner img
{
margin:0 0 0 auto;
}


/*x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x Side Menus Mods x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x*/
.sidemenuscon
{
height:486px;
background:url(../pics/bg_sidemenuscon.png) no-repeat;
margin:0 0 0 0;
}

.sidemenus_innercon
{
height:486px;
position:relative;
}

.sm_generic, .sm_dripwell, .sm_mudlug, .sm_pivotrx, .sm_1tripr, .sm_gone, .sm_agriinject, .sm_roto, .sm_egress, .sm_watsonfloat, .sm_railcar, .sm_wyoming, .sm_gatemate
{
width:262px;
height:394px;
position:absolute;
top:90px;
left:11px;
}

.sm_generic
{
background:url(../pics/sm_generic.png) no-repeat;
}

.sm_dripwell
{
background:url(../pics/sm_dripwell.png) no-repeat;
}

.sm_mudlug
{
background:url(../pics/sm_mudlug.png) no-repeat;
}

.sm_pivotrx
{
background:url(../pics/sm_pivotrx.png) no-repeat;
}

.sm_1tripr
{
background:url(../pics/sm_1tripr.png) no-repeat;
}

.sm_gone
{
background:url(../pics/sm_goneinsect.png) no-repeat;
}

.sm_agriinject
{
background:url(../pics/sm_agriinject.png) no-repeat;
}

.sm_roto
{
background:url(../pics/sm_aceroto.png) no-repeat;
}


.sm_egress
{
background:url(../pics/sm_egress.png) no-repeat;
}

.sm_watsonfloat
{
background:url(../pics/sm_watsonfloat.png) no-repeat;
}

.sm_railcar
{
background:url(../pics/sm_railcar.png) no-repeat;
}

.sm_wyoming
{
background:url(../pics/sm_wyomingelk.png) no-repeat;
}

.sm_gatemate
{
background:url(../pics/sm_gatemate.png) no-repeat;
}

.sm_linker_dripwell, .sm_linker_mudlug, .sm_linker_pivotrx, .sm_linker_1tripr, .sm_linker_gone, .sm_linker_agriinject, .sm_linker_roto, .sm_linker_egress, .sm_linker_railcar, .sm_linker_gatemate
{
width:262px;
height:23px;
position:absolute;
left:11px;
}

.sm_linker_gone, .sm_linker_watsonfloat, .sm_linker_wyoming
{
width:262px;
height:42px;
position:absolute;
left:11px;
}

.sm_linker_dripwell
{
top:94px;
}

.sm_linker_mudlug
{
top:122px;
}

.sm_linker_pivotrx
{
top:150px;
}

.sm_linker_1tripr
{
top:177px;
}

.sm_linker_gone
{
top:203px;
}

.sm_linker_agriinject
{
top:249px;
}

.sm_linker_roto
{
top:276px;
}

.sm_linker_egress
{
top:303px;
}

.sm_linker_watsonfloat
{
top:330px;
}

.sm_linker_railcar
{
top:375px;
}

.sm_linker_wyoming
{
top:401px;
}

.sm_linker_gatemate
{
top:447px;
}

.sm_linker_generic_upper, .sm_linker_generic_side, .sm_linker_generic_bottom
{
position:absolute;
}

.sm_linker_generic_upper
{
width:273px;
height:92px;
top:0;
left:0;
}

.sm_linker_generic_side
{
width:11px;
height:486px;
top:0;
left:0;
}

.sm_linker_generic_bottom
{
width:273px;
height:18px;
top:473px;
left:0;
}


.cmr_photobox
{
width:155px;
height:155px;
float:left;
margin:10px 10px 0 0;
position:relative;
}

.cmr_firstline
{
margin-top:0px;
}

.cmr_lastline
{
margin-right:0px;
}


.cmr_photo
{
position:absolute;
top:0;
left:0;
}



.cm_rightcon
{
width:655px;
float:left;
}

.cm_rightcon_innercon
{
width:640px;
}

.bottom_button
{
margin:0 0 0 0;
text-align:right;
padding-right:20px;
}


.cm_rightcon_contactus
{
width:570px;
float:left;
}

.cf_doms
{
width:60px;
float:left;
clear:left;
margin:8px 20px 0 0;
text-align:right;
}

.cf_defs
{
width:400px;
float:left;
margin:8px 0 0 0;
}


.cf_defs_submitarea
{
width:415px;
float:left;
margin:8px 0 0 0;
}

.cf_captcha
{
float:left;
margin:0 10px 0 0;
}

.cf_verify_textfield
{
width:70px;
float:left;
margin:0 10px 0 0;
}

.cf_submitbutton
{
width:128px;
height:47px;
background:url(../pics/button_submit.png) no-repeat;
border:none;
cursor:pointer;
float:right;
}

.cf_error
{
font-size:8pt;
color:#ffc600;
}

.content_bottomcon
{
height:12px;
background:url(../pics/bg_contentbottom.png) no-repeat;
}

.dripwell_logocon
{
height:196px;
position:relative;
text-align:center;
margin:10px 0 0 0;
}

.mudlug_subbanner
{
text-align:center;
margin:10px 0 0 0;
}

.photocon_center
{
text-align:center;
}

.photocon_right
{
text-align:right;
}

.mrdrip_mask
{
position:absolute;
top:-7px;
left:102px;
}

.cm_product_infos
{
width:640px;
}

.dripwell_photo1
{
float:right;
margin:0 0 15px 20px;
}

.dripwell_photofloat2
{
float:left;
margin:0 30px 15px 0;
}

.dripwell_photo2con
{
text-align:center;
margin:30px 0 30px 0;
}

.aceroto_subbanner
{
height:1251px;
position:relative;
}

.aceroto_labels
{
color:#2d4c85;
font-size:8pt;
position:absolute;
}


.ace_label1
{
top:340px;
left:68px;
}

.ace_label2
{
top:670px;
left:370px;
}

.ace_label3
{
top:670px;
left:68px;
}

.ace_label4
{
top:965px;
left:280px;
}

.ace_label5
{
top:965px;
left:480px;
}

.ace_label6
{
top:1190px;
left:68px;
}


.ace_label7
{
top:350px;
left:420px;
}

.ace_label8
{
top:955px;
left:68px;
}

.ace_label9
{
top:1195px;
left:370px;
}

.product_12_desc
{
width:460px;
float:left;
}

.watson_productscon
{
position:relative;
height:677px;
}

.watson_labels
{
color:#2d4c85;
font-size:8pt;
position:absolute;
text-align:center;
}

.w_label1
{
top:295px;
left:75px;
}

.w_label2
{
top:295px;
left:355px;
}

.w_label3
{
top:620px;
left:230px;
}

/*x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x Footer MODS xxxxxxxxxxxxxxxxxxxxxxxxxxx*/
.footercon
{
text-align:center;
margin:20px 0 0 0;
}


























